#141278 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#141278 is composed of 7.8% red, 7.1%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.3% cyan, 85%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 241.2 degrees, a saturation of 73.9% and a lightness of 27.1%. #141278 color hex could be obtained by blending #2824f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

#141278 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#141278 has RGB values of R:20, G:18,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0.85, Y:0,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 1315448.

Shades and Tints of #141278
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#efeffd is the lightest one.
